The charity supports children and young people, elderly people, people with disabilities, people of a particular ethnic or racial origin, and other charities or voluntary bodies. Christadelphian Meal A Day Fund is a registered charity whose purpose is education and training. It delivers its work by making grants to organisations. The charity is based in Notts and operates in Bosnia And Herzegovina, Botswana, and various other locations.

Activities & Mission

As a practical witness we seek to facilitate personal and community dignity of those in real need in less developed parts of the world by sustainable local projects which: a) help to relieve the effects of hunger disease disability destitution homelessness b) promote agriculture clean water basic health care education c) encourage sharing learning service to others and community development
